The Glass Menagerie was first performed during our opening season in 1949 and we are pleased to revive this classic for our 60th Anniversary. The Glass Menagerie is recognized as one of the most famous plays in modern theatre.

The Story…

Amanda, a single parent, is determined to improve the lives of her children. Daughter Laura is withdrawn within her illusionary world and son Tom is rebellious and years for adventure. This entertaining memory play uses humour and pathos to examine a family unravelling, lost in their individual fantasies and dreams.

Our Cast…

The Red Barn Theatre is proud to announce that Fiona Reid, one of Canada’s most celebrated actresses, will be starring in our production of Tennessee William’s classic The Glass Menagerie. Having starred at every major theatre across Canada (including the Shaw and Stratford Festivals and CanStage), Ms. Reid is the recipient of two Dora Awards, a Jessie Award and a Gemini Nomination. Ever since audiences first came to know and love her as Larry’s wife on TV’s King of Kensington, she has been wowing legions of fans with her comic talent, dramatic range and emotional honesty. Fiona Reid was born to play “Amanda Wingfield” and The Red Barn Theatre is honoured to have Canada’s favourite leading lady headlining our Diamond Anniversary Season.

We are also very excited to announce that Jonathan Crombie will join us direct from starring on Broadway in The Drowsy Chaperone to play “Tom” in The Glass Menagerie. Jonathan Crombie is internationally known to audiences as “Gilbert Blythe” in all three installments of the Anne of Green Gables mini-series. Jonathan’s credits also include two seasons on the hit TV series Slings and Arrows and as “Romeo” at The Stratford Festival.

Michelle Monteith will play “Laura”, a role for which she won The Montreal English Critics Circle Award as Best Actress. Brendan Murray, who has played major roles at The Centaur Theatre, The Citadel Theatre and The National Arts Centre, will play the gentlemen caller “Jim”.
